Actually although you can identify yourself with Beta Theta, you would always be identified with the Alpha Lambda chapter in terms of Alpha Phi International records in the computer system.

As a fellow AI, although I identify with my collegiate chapter (since I was a colony member that wasn't installed until after graduation) I also believe its important we make it known that we are AI's.
If you find your group through an alum chapter, I personally think this makes much more sense. For example, one of our alum initiates is from Texas but her chapter designation is that of a chapter in Michigan since that's where her sponsor was from. I doubt if she has ever even been to Michigan...I would feel very funny saying "I am a member of so and so chapter" if my only connection to it was a single member.

However, if you're a colony member or longtime advisor being initiated, or you have a lot of interaction with the collegians prior to your initiation (see post below), I would say go with the chapter you have been attached to.
